Local Planning Notes
Tourism, family gatherings, cultural events, or short stays should be supported with practical dates and accommodation details.
Invitation letters, address details, relationship proof, and support documents should match the forms and travel plan.
Employment, school, business, property, family, or other obligations outside Canada should be explained where available.
